Output 01802096a5b8c0a1131bda172623252f0dea5f22e701b0f8bd2f50fb1fee16c2:0

value
12689944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d18e1aa200e2e922e4b808555ef8618f60fc5cb4 OP_EQUAL
address
3Lo3PCRPcZrtsD5a8k9dAwhRCgBpuPWjjL
transaction
01802096a5b8c0a1131bda172623252f0dea5f22e701b0f8bd2f50fb1fee16c2
spent
true